The Kingdom of Prussia was a German kingdom that constituted the state of Prussia between 1701 and 1918. It was the driving force behind the unification of Germany in 1871 and was the leading state of the German Empire until its dissolution in 1918. Although it took its name from the region called Prussia, it was based in the Margraviate of Brandenburg. Its capital was Berlin. The kings of Prussia were from the House of Hohenzollern. The arms show the major 52 territories that belonged to Prussia at that time. The original Prussian arms are shown as the escutcheon. The banners show the eagle of Brandenburg (red) and the eagle of Preussen proper (black). The 52 territories are listed at the end of ...

What is Germany’s motto? The opening line of the third stanza, “Einigkeit und Recht und Freiheit” (“Unity and Justice and Freedom”), is widely considered to be the national motto of Germany, although it was never officially proclaimed as such. snowflake concat wsNettetCoat of arms of the Kingdom of Prussia (1871–1914), in the era of Wilhelm II.
